Kakamega Homeboyz's Paul Adam (left) in action against Mohamed Abdullah of Al Hilal Benghazi from Libya during their CAF Confederation Cup first preliminary round match at Nyayo Stadium. [Stafford Ondego, Standard]
Wasteful Kakamega Homeboyz will only have themselves to blame after being held to a barren draw by Al Hilal Benghazi of Libya during their CAF Confederation Cup preliminary first leg encounter at Nyayo Stadium on Saturday.
The FKF Cup champions struggled to establish themselves as an attacking force in the both halves of the encounter with Homeboyz's striker Ambrose Sifuna one of the culprits after missing a clear scoring opportunity in the opening 13th minute.
